Primary bladder amyloidosis is a rare disease causing hematuria which is difficult to be differenciated from bladder cancer at cystoscope. We report a case of primary bladder amyloidosis who was diagnosed at other procedure for distal ureteral stone failed in repeated ESWL disintegration. Transurethral resection of bladder mass and the pathologic results revealed amyloidosis. The systemic studies for the detection of the site of other amyloidosis were failed to get positive result. There were massive hematuria after a few hours later from the transurethral resection of the bladder mass and the bleeding was controlled with 1% alum bladder irrigation. The patient is followed regularly for recurrent amyloidosis.

A case of congenital periureteral bladder diverticulum is described. Bladder outflow obstruction and urinary tract infection were the presenting symptoms of a 2 year old boy. There were two diverticula in the bladder. The one was small (1 x 2cm) and located just above the right ureteral orifice and the other was large (8 x 10cm) and located at the left trigone. There was no hydronephrosis, and vesicoureteral reflux, neither. A simple diverticulectomy was performed. The left ureteral orifice was found at the medial side of the diverticulum's neck during operation. During follow up, bilateral high grade vesicoureteral reflux were discovered and urinary tract infections developed frequently. Eventually, ureteral reimplantation was done one year after the diverticulectomy.

Until now, we do not have specific Korean data on the age related prostatic volume and voiding symptoms associated with prostatic volume among randomized aged population. Due to this problem, we studied the correlations on the age, prostatic volume and voiding symptom among random sampled 255 people over the age 60 from the 11 Myun in Chinyang Gun, Kyungsangnam-do from the July 12th to July 26th, 1993. The mean age of the examined people was 71.5 years. 244 people answered on questionaire for voiding symptom scoring and 224 people agreed on the transrectal ultrasonic measurement of the prostatic volume. The prolate spheroid method and elliptical method were used for the measurement of the prostatic volume with the major transverse diameter, major anteroposterior diameter and cephalocaudal diameter of each prostates as Terris. The volume of the prostate ranged from 6.2cc to 54.5cc ( Prolate spheroid method ) and 4.7cc to 44.1cc(Elliptical method ). The prostate volumes measured by the elliptical method were smaller than that measured by prolate spheroid method in each age group. The average prostatic volume measured by the elliptical volume and prolate spheroid method were 17.7/22.5cc(E/P) in age 61 to 65 group(n=17), 19.9/22.8cc in age 66 to 70 group(n= 88), 21.6/ 26.0cc in age 71 to 75 group(n=71), 24.4/27.7cc in age 76 to 80 group(n=34) and 18.1/23.7cc in age over 80 group(n =14) and the pattern of the changes in the prostatic volume related with aging was significant(p 0.05).

We report an unusual case of clitoral hypertrophy due to neurofibromatosis of external genitalia. The patient also had definite skin lesions and family history. The patient was treated successfully by clitorectomy. The patient seems to be the first case of clitoral neurofibromatosis reported in Korean literature.
